Electrical Durability
2000 cycle | 60 cycles per hour
Mechanical Durability
10000 cycle | 60 cycles per hour
Number of Poles
3P
Power Loss
at Rated Operating Conditions per Pole 77 W
Rated Current (In)
1600 A
Rated Impulse Withstand Voltage (Uimp)
8 kV
Rated Insulation Voltage (Ui)
1000 V
Rated Operational Voltage
690 V AC
Rated Service Short-Circuit Breaking Capacity (Ics)
(220 V AC) 85 kA | (230 V AC) 85 kA | (380 V AC) 50 kA | (400 V AC) 50 kA | (415 V AC) 50 kA | (440 V AC) 50 kA | (500 V AC) 40 kA | (690 V AC) 30 kA
Rated Short-time Withstand Current Low Voltage (Icw)
for 1 s 20 kA
Rated Ultimate Short-Circuit Breaking Capacity (Icu)
(220 V AC) 85 kA | (230 V AC) 85 kA | (380 V AC) 50 kA | (400 V AC) 50 kA | (415 V AC) 50 kA | (440 V AC) 50 kA | (500 V AC) 40 kA | (690 V AC) 30 kA
Rated Uninterrupted Current (Iu)
1600 A
Release
PR332/P LSIG
Release Type
EL
Short-Circuit Performance Level
S
Standards
IEC
Sub-type
T7
Terminal Connection Type
Fixed Circuit-Breakers | Front

This 3P fixed‑front terminal breaker is designed for panelboard installations at up to 690 V AC. Its front‑terminal connection simplifies wiring and reduces assembly time, while the 1600 A rating provides headroom for high‑load feeders. Ensure clearance and enclosure ratings meet IP 54/IEC requirements for your environment and verify compatible busbar spacing with the panel design.
Key specs include a rated service short‑circuit breaking capacity (Ics/Icu) up to 85 kA at common voltages and a 30 kA rating at 690 V. The device also provides 20 kA short‑time withstand for 1 s, ensuring rapid and reliable interruption in surge events. These figures support transformer and motor feeder protection in Tmax T7 installations.
